Knicks sign Lamar Odom for remainder of season

Lamar Odom has signed to the New York Knicks for the remainder of the season.

Knicks President Phil Jackson announced the news Thursday, however he remained tight lipped on the terms of the deal.

Odom has been surrounded by controversy in his personal life this season, with his alleged drug abuse and cheating on his wife, Khloe Kardashian.

After being dropped by the LA Clippers, Odom appeared in two games for Spanish team Baskonia.

The veteran forward and troubled reality-TV star has signed a deal for “the remainder of the season” with a non-guaranteed second year in 2014-15.

Odom’s non-guaranteed second year on his contract — likely for the veteran minimum — also will make him available to be included in any trades this summer for salary-cap purposes.

Odom’s signing reunites him with Knicks president Phil Jackson, who was head coach of the Los Angeles Lakers for Odom’s tenure there.
